Casa Italiana in Burien will host a car show on Saturday, July 26, 2025, from 11 a. m. to 2 p. m. , inviting the public to celebrate Italian automotive culture.

The event welcomes owners of Italian cars and motorcycles, including renowned brands like Ferrari, Lamborghini, and Vespa. Attendees can look forward to an impressive lineup of vehicles and various food options, such as on-site pizza and grilled sausage sandwiches priced at $10. This annual event has established itself as a popular gathering for car enthusiasts in the area.
